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

fhuF
Putative TonB-dependent receptor; Ferrioxamine B receptor precursor, FhuF. Iron-regulated outer membrane protein that bind and uptake ferrioxamine in association with the TonB protein. Involved in the reduction of ferric iron in cytoplasmic ferrioxamine B. Binds 1 2Fe-2S cluster. In e.coli the fhuF gene reacts very sensitive to minor changes of Fe2+ and Fur(Ferric uptake regulator). SWISSPROT: FOXA_SALTY.
